在这个数字化时代,编程已经成为了每个人都需要掌握的一项基本技能。原子组件作为现代编程的重要组成部分,对于初学者来说既神秘又充满诱惑。别担心,快手小组将带你一步步揭开编程的神秘面纱,让你轻松掌握原子组件的奥秘。
什么是原子组件?
首先,让我们来了解一下什么是原子组件。原子组件是构成复杂用户界面(UI)的基本单元,就像乐高积木一样,通过组合不同的原子组件可以构建出各种复杂的界面。在许多现代前端框架中,如React、Vue和Angular中,原子组件是构建高效、可维护和可扩展UI的基础。
快手小组带你入门
第一步:认识你的工具箱
在开始之前,你需要准备好你的工具。快手小组会向你推荐以下工具:
- 代码编辑器:如Visual Studio Code、Sublime Text等。
- 前端框架:根据你的喜好选择React、Vue或Angular等。
- 在线学习平台:如freeCodeCamp、Codecademy等。
第二步:基础概念
接下来,我们需要了解一些基础概念:
- 组件化:将UI拆分为可重用的组件。
- 状态管理:如何在不同组件间传递数据。
- 事件处理:如何响应用户的操作。
第三步:动手实践
快手小组会通过一系列的实践项目来帮助你掌握原子组件:
- 创建一个简单的按钮组件:学习如何定义组件、设置属性和渲染内容。
- 组合多个组件:了解如何将不同的组件组合在一起创建复杂的界面。
- 动态内容:学习如何根据数据动态更改组件内容。
// React示例:一个简单的按钮组件
class Button extends React.Component {
render() {
return <button>{this.props.label}</button>;
}
}
第四步:进阶技巧
一旦你掌握了基础的原子组件,快手小组将带你学习一些高级技巧:
- 样式和主题:学习如何使用CSS或框架内置的样式系统。
- 响应式设计:了解如何让组件在不同设备上看起来都很好。
- 性能优化:学习如何提升组件的加载速度和渲染效率。
第五步:持续学习和实践
编程是一项需要不断学习和实践的活动。快手小组会鼓励你:
- 阅读文档:熟悉你使用的前端框架的文档。
- 加入社区:参与在线论坛和社群,与其他开发者交流。
- 开源贡献:尝试为开源项目做贡献,提升实战经验。
总结
原子组件虽然看似复杂,但通过快手小组的引导和你的努力,你可以轻松上手并掌握编程的奥秘。记住,编程不仅仅是编写代码,更是一种思维方式的培养。相信自己,持续学习,你将成为一位出色的程序员。
